Patente
Im September berichteten wir, dass IBM hinter dem chinesischen E-Commerce-Riesen Alibaba den zweiten Platz auf einer iPR Daily Liste belegte, in der globale Organisationen nach der Anzahl der von ihnen eingereichten Blockchain-Patente eingestuft wurden.
Die Medien nutzten bis zum 10. August Daten aus ganz China, der EU, Amerika, Japan und Südkorea und konsultierte auch das Internationale Patentsystem der Weltorganisation für geistiges Eigentum (WIPO).
Alibaba reichte 90 Blockchain-bezogene Patentanmeldungen ein, IBM lag mit 89.
